What is the role of a laboratory hydraulic press in high-loading NCM811 cathode prep for solid-state batteries?


The primary role of a laboratory hydraulic press in this context is to ensure structural integrity and electrical continuity. Specifically for high-loading NCM811 cathodes, the press applies precise, uniform pressure to establish tight mechanical contact between the active material, conductive agents, and the current collector. This mechanical processing is the prerequisite for effective electrochemical function.

Core Takeaway High-loading cathodes offer energy density benefits but struggle with internal resistance and electrolyte access. The hydraulic press solves this by increasing compaction density and ensuring the electrolyte precursor fully infiltrates the cathode pores, which is essential for reducing contact resistance and maximizing rate performance.

The Mechanics of Cathode Optimization

To understand why the hydraulic press is indispensable, one must look beyond simple compression. It functions as a tool for microstructural engineering, directly addressing the challenges of thick, high-loading electrodes.

Increasing Compaction Density

High-loading NCM811 cathodes contain a large volume of active material. Without sufficient density, the electron pathways are fragmented.

The hydraulic press exerts uniform force to pack these particles closely together. This maximizes the volumetric energy density of the electrode plate. It ensures that the active material is not just a loose powder, but a cohesive structural unit.

Facilitating Electrolyte Infiltration

A unique challenge in solid-state battery fabrication involves getting the electrolyte into the dense cathode structure.

The press plays a critical role during in-situ polymerization. By applying pressure, it forces the liquid electrolyte precursor to penetrate deep into the pores of the cathode before it solidifies. This ensures that when the polymer forms, it creates a continuous ion-conductive network throughout the entire electrode thickness.

Reducing Contact Resistance

Resistance at the interfaces is a primary killer of battery performance. This includes the interface between particles and the interface between the electrode and the current collector.

The press minimizes this resistance by mechanically locking the components together. It eliminates air gaps and voids that would otherwise act as insulators. This tight contact allows electrons to move freely, which is vital for high-rate charging and discharging.

Understanding the Trade-offs

While pressure is necessary, it is not a case of "more is always better." You must apply pressure with a strategic understanding of the material limits.

The Risks of Over-Pressurization

Applying excessive force can be detrimental to the battery's longevity.

According to thermodynamic analysis, pressure must be maintained at appropriate levels (typically below 100 MPa). Exceeding this limit can induce unwanted material phase changes. It may also crush the cathode particles or the solid electrolyte, leading to irreversible damage.

Balancing Porosity and Contact

There is a delicate balance between density and accessibility.

Extreme densification creates excellent electrical contact but may close off pores required for ion transport. The hydraulic press must be set to a "sweet spot" that achieves high compaction density while preserving just enough porosity for the electrolyte precursor to infiltrate effectively.

Making the Right Choice for Your Goal

The specific application of pressure depends on what performance metric you are trying to maximize for your NCM811 cathode.

  • If your primary focus is Volumetric Energy Density: Prioritize higher compaction pressures to minimize void volume and maximize the amount of active material per unit volume.
  • If your primary focus is Rate Performance: Use moderate, highly controlled pressure to ensure the electrolyte precursor can fully permeate the electrode structure without closing off ion pathways.
  • If your primary focus is Cycle Stability: Focus on uniform pressure distribution to prevent localized stress points that could lead to crack propagation or delamination over time.

Optimization lies in using the press not just to flatten material, but to precisely engineer the void space and interface contact of the cathode.
